You may diversify additional by owning a number of teams of assets at the same time, like shares and bonds. Generally speaking, bonds are more stable than stocks and will boost in worth when stocks are carrying out improperly. By owning each, you may be able to produce a far more secure and balanced portfolio.

While you in the Our site vicinity of retirement, a financial planner may help you get ready for a scientific withdrawal strategy. Following developing a diversified portfolio, you’ll just withdraw money each month. Ideally, the annualized rate is 4% from the portfolio or much less – the more you withdraw, the upper the risk that you just’ll start to erode principal if investment markets decrease in worth.
